Landscape Drainage in Birmingham, AL
Landscape drainage services focus on improving the way water moves across residential properties to prevent pooling, erosion, and water damage. These services typically include installing drainage systems such as French drains, surface drains, and swales, as well as grading and contouring land to direct excess water away from foundations, walkways, and lawns. Homeowners often request this type of work when dealing with persistent standing water after storms, soggy yards, or concerns about water seeping into basements or crawl spaces.
Before requesting landscape drainage services, property owners should consider the specific drainage issues they face and the areas most affected. It’s helpful to understand the property’s slope and existing landscape features, as well as any drainage patterns that need improvement. Clarifying the scope of the project-such as whether the goal is to protect a garden, improve yard usability, or safeguard the foundation-can ensure the chosen solutions effectively address the property’s unique needs.

Landscape Drainage Questions
What are common landscape drainage solutions? Common solutions include French drains, surface grading, and swale installation to direct water away from structures and prevent pooling.
How does proper drainage benefit a property? Proper drainage helps protect foundations, reduces erosion, and prevents water accumulation that can lead to landscaping damage.
What signs indicate a drainage issue? Signs include standing water, soggy areas, erosion, or water pooling near foundations after heavy rain.
Can drainage improvements be integrated into existing landscapes? Yes, drainage systems can often be added or upgraded without extensive disruption to existing landscaping features.
